    According to The Red Book's Peace Dollar book, 47% of all silver dollars from 1878-1904 were melted down to help the British cover their paper during the end of WWI. Zee Germans were successful in their propaganda machine in scaring the Indian population into hoarding silver.

    So, we helped the British out and sold them a lot of silver for $1 per .77 oz of pure silver, plus 1.5 cents per coin for smelting and transport. This depleted the US Treas of silver dollars and voila, the 1921 Morgan was minted from fresh silver from domestic mines.
